Although the dress code at Palais Garnier isn’t strictly enforced, you are expected to wear something that reflects the style and grace this legendary venue deserves.
Whether it’s an opera or ballet, dressing with a bit of elegance is a way to honor the spirit of this legendary setting.
For evening performances, you should wear formal or semi-formal attire, such as cocktail dresses, dress shirts, and suits.
Daytime events or tours are more relaxed, allowing for smart casual wear.
This could include dressy trousers or skirts paired with stylish tops.
However, it’s best to avoid overly casual choices like shorts, flip-flops, or athletic wear.

For Little Ones
There isn’t a strict dress code at Palais Garnier for kids, either, so they can dress comfortably while still looking presentable.
They can wear a simple T-shirt, sweatshirt, sweater, dress, or hoodie.
When it comes to bottoms, jeans, shorts, leggings, or even joggers are all great options.
To complete their look, a pair of sneakers or casual shoes will keep their feet comfortable.

1. Can I wear jeans at Palais Garnier?
Yes, you can wear jeans at the Palais Garnier, but only during daytime events. It’s best to avoid jeans and opt for formal attire during the evening performances to align with the more elegant dress code expected at this venue.
2. What is the dress code for Palais Garnier opera house?
When dressing for Palais Garnier, consider the cultural emphasis on elegance in Parisian fashion. Aim for a polished, sophisticated look that reflects the venue’s historic significance and the grandeur of the performances.
3. Can children follow the same dress code at Palais Garnier?
Yes, kids can dress comfortably while still looking presentable. There isn’t a strict dress code for children at Palais Garnier, so they can wear items like t-shirts, sweatshirts, jeans, or dresses paired with sneakers or casual shoes.
4. Are there any clothing items I should avoid at Palais Garnier?
While the Palais Garnier dress code is flexible, it’s best to steer clear of overly casual pieces like flip-flops, ripped clothing, or athletic wear, especially for evening events.
5. What should I do if I feel uncertain about what to wear?
If you are unsure about your outfit, it’s always better to be slightly overdressed than underdressed. A good rule of thumb is to aim for smart casual for daytime events and dressier attire for the evening.
